    Key Features to Look For

    When shopping for Under Armour safety shoes, keep an eye out for these essential features to ensure you're getting the right pair for your needs:

    • Toe Protection: Steel toes are the traditional choice for impact and compression resistance, while composite toes offer similar protection with a lighter weight and non-conductivity. Choose the option that best suits your specific work environment and safety requirements.
    • Slip Resistance: Look for outsoles with aggressive tread patterns and materials designed to provide excellent grip on wet, oily, or uneven surfaces. This is crucial for preventing slips and falls in hazardous work environments.
    • Puncture Resistance: If your job involves working around sharp objects, consider safety shoes with puncture-resistant midsoles. These midsoles prevent nails, screws, and other sharp objects from penetrating the sole and injuring your foot.
    • Electrical Hazard (EH) Protection: If you work around electricity, choose safety shoes that are rated for electrical hazard protection. These shoes are designed to insulate you from electrical shock and reduce the risk of injury.
    • Water Resistance: Depending on your work environment, you may need safety shoes that are water-resistant or waterproof. Look for shoes with waterproof membranes and sealed seams to keep your feet dry in wet conditions.
    • Comfort Features: Don't overlook comfort features like cushioned insoles, padded collars, and breathable linings. These features can make a big difference in how your feet feel after a long day on the job.
    • Fit: A proper fit is essential for both comfort and safety. Make sure to try on safety shoes before you buy them and walk around to ensure they feel comfortable and supportive. Consider getting your feet professionally measured to ensure you're choosing the correct size.

    How to Care for Your Under Armour Safety Shoes

    To maximize the lifespan and performance of your Under Armour safety shoes, proper care and maintenance are essential. Here are some tips to keep them in top condition:

    • Clean Regularly: Wipe down your shoes regularly with a damp cloth to remove dirt, grime, and debris. For tougher stains, use a mild soap and water solution. Avoid har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ners, as they can damage the materials.
    • Dry Properly: If your shoes get wet, allow them to air dry completely before wearing them again. Remove the insoles to speed up the drying process. Avoid using direct heat sources like hair dryers or radiators, as they can cause the materials to shrink or crack.
    • Store Properly: When you're not wearing your safety shoes, store them in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ight and extreme temperatures. This will help prevent the materials from deteriorating.
    • Inspect Regularly: Periodically inspect your shoes for signs of wear and tear, such as cracks, tears, or worn outsoles. Replace your shoes if you notice any significant damage that could compromise their safety or performance.
    • Replace Insoles: The insoles of your safety shoes can wear out over time, reducing their comfort and support. Replace them as needed with new insoles to maintain optimal cushioning and shock absorption.
    • Use Shoe Trees: Shoe trees can help maintain the shape of your safety shoes and prevent them from creasing or wrinkling. This is especially helpful for leather shoes.
